注册 登录
编程论坛 ASP技术论坛

未指定的错误conn.Open connstr

qjping 发布于 2010-03-20 16:09, 1905 次点击
<%
DataPath="DataBase/Data.mdb"
connstr="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" +server.mappath(sqlpath&DataPath)
Set conn= Server.CreateObject("ADODB.Connection")
conn.Open connstr
%>
出现下面的错误,高手指正一下
Microsoft JET Database Engine 错误 '80004005'

未指定的错误

/Conn.asp,行5
5 回复
#2
孤独冷雨2010-03-20 16:26
sqlpath&
这个是什么意思啊?
#3
qjping2010-03-20 16:31
<%
DataPath="DataBase/Data.mdb"
connstr="DBQ="+server.mappath(""&DataPath&"")+";DefaultDir=;DRIVER={Microsoft Access Driver (*.mdb)};"
Set conn= Server.CreateObject("ADODB.Connection")
conn.Open connstr
%>
这样也是同样错误
#4
孤独冷雨2010-03-20 16:36
<%
DataPath="DataBase/Data.mdb"
connstr="prov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(DataPath)
Set conn= Server.CreateObject("ADODB.Connection")
conn.Open connstr
%>
#5
qjping2010-03-20 17:08
还是下面的错误,谢谢版主热心帮助:
Microsoft JET Database Engine 错误 '80004005'

未指定的错误

/Conn.asp,行5
#6
孤独冷雨2010-03-20 17:17
是你是你对数据库没有操作权限啊?你给数据库加一个everyone权限
1